Why Professional Sewage Cleanup Beats DIY Cleanup in Garfield

Plenty of Garfield hom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

What makes DIY cleanup risky isn't the initial mop-up — it's everything you can't see afterward. Standard household fans move air across a surface, but they don't pull moisture out of building materials the way commercial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ers do. That gap is exactly where Garfield homeowners end up with mold problems weeks or months down the line.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Garfield hom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Garfield property.

While You Wait

Six Things To Do Before We Arrive

The minutes before our Garfield crew arrives matter. Here's what our dispatchers typically recommend, situation permitting.

1

Shut Off the Water Source

If the water is coming from a pipe, appliance, or fixture you can safely reach, shut off the supply valve or main.

2

Stay Clear of Outlets

Never touch electrical switches, outlets, or appliances that are wet or near standing water — the risk of shock is real.

3

Protect What You Can

Lifting rugs, moving boxes, and relocating valuables can reduce secondary damage while you wait for our team.

4

Take Photos First

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ved — this helps your insurance claim later.

5

Open Windows & Doors

Some airflow can help, but don't rely on it alone — professional drying equipment is still necessary to prevent mold.
